How to Get $250 from Bank of America’s Best Value Guarantee


I just received my $250 check from Bank of America for meeting the requirements for their Best Value Guarantee. The following is the detail of how this check came to my mailbox and what you can do to get your $250.

I’ll start with a little background…

First, please go here to see how the whole mortgage search process went. During that time I discovered the Bank of America No Fee Mortgage PLUS and the Best Value Guarantee.You can read more about the No Fee Mortgage plus here and here. Basically, they try and offer you the best deal on a mortgage that they can (without some fees) and will even view your other offers to try and beat them. And this is the part that got me excited…the Best Value Guarantee…if they can’t provide a better value than your other offers they will pay you $250. I knew then that I had to at least give Bank of America a shot.

Meeting the Requirements for the BOA Best Value Guarantee

OK, here’s how to get the $250:

…ultimately, according to the fine print, this is all you need to do:

1. Receive full credit approval for the first lien purchase money mortgage with Bank of America

2. Close your purchase mortgage with another lender

3. Call 800.870.3206 where you will be prompted to complete a brief survey

4. Fax a copy of your HUD-1 settlement statement from your closing

5. Close on your purchase loan within 60 calendar days after Bank of America sent you notice of the approval of your Bank of America mortgage

6. Wait

I Did it the Dumb Way

However, I chose to do it this way, which may or may not have delayed the process ;)

8/17/2007 – Applied for the Bank of America loan

9/28/2007 – Closed on the mortgage with the builder’s lender and moved into our new home

10/17/2007 – Called my Bank of America Loan Officer and was given the number to the Best Value Guarantee department (866.540.9746) where I was transferred to Anne (the person who handles these claims…she’s literally the only person at BOA who does this…can you say “bottleneck!”)

10/17/2007 – Anne told me to fax my closing HUD to her at 800.272.0562

10/17/2007 – Faxed the final HUD Settlement Statement to Bank of America

11/7/2007 – Received a letter from Bank of America stating that the “survey was not completed” and that I was not eligible

11/8/2007 – Because the letter did not tell me how to take the survey and because I was having trouble getting back to Anne, I Googled “Bank of America Best Value Guarantee” and found this page http://nofeemortgageplus.bankofamerica.com/terms.html

11/8/2007 – Called 800.870.3206 and completed the survey

11/8/2007 – Finally got a hold of Anne at 866.540.9746 to inform her that I completed the survey

12/11/2007 – Called Anne at 866.540.9746 to ask where my check was and was told it was in the mail

12/12/2007 – Check arrived!

Was it Worth the Time and Effort?

I estimate that I ended up spending about 2 or 3 hours making phone calls, completing the survey, and faxing the HUD. This could have been minimized, as could my effort and frustration, had I simply followed the standard process. Still, Bank of America doesn’t make it easy to understand and follow this process and claim your $250. And it will tax you to get all of this done and it seem worth it. Hopefully this post will help you to get there quicker than I did. Ultimately I’d say it was worth it. I mean, it’s $250 I didn’t have yesterday.
